Analysis of Various Textural Descriptors for Ovarian Cyst Classification
Ovarian cyst is one of the main causes of infertility. Ovarian cancers are also caused by the ovarian cyst that grows in the ovary. An ovarian cyst can be benign (non-cancerous) or malignant (cancerous). If the cyst is not diagnosed and treated at the earliest, the benign cyst may turn into malignant and can be fatal. Various image processing techniques are used to assist the clinicians to characterize the ovarian cyst using the textural descriptor. This paper reviews several textural descriptors for feature extraction like Local Binary Pattern (LBP), Local Directional Pattern (LDP) and Local Optimal Oriented Pattern (LOOP). Finally, extracted features are applied to SVM, KNN and Ensemble classifiers to compare the performance of the textural descriptors.
